Output 63e58754bd52d6e7eb0d0e18cd6058119b4b98a78e029d9000043d3d8783fd13:0

value
512700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41db61b1a4eb55d7c51cd7bf779951ef89a89df9 OP_EQUAL
address
37hEev1JGyovjVKpCsrscd6zb8ZqcNpqVU
transaction
63e58754bd52d6e7eb0d0e18cd6058119b4b98a78e029d9000043d3d8783fd13
spent
true